The Japan Craft Sake Breweries Association was founded in 2022 underneath the Management of Shuhei Okazumi of Ine to Agave Brewery. The Affiliation hopes to attract children and ladies who definitely have not been Repeated sake drinkers, and due to superior included value, many craft sake are priced at about 2 times the price of standard sake.[97][ninety eight]

The Liquor Tax Regulation definition would not allow sake being created with secondary substances, but considering that craft sake will not be certain from the Liquor Tax Regulation definition, fruits and herbs in many cases are utilised as secondary ingredients.

Additional breweries also are turning to more mature ways of creation. As an example, since the 21st century, using picket tubs has greater once again because of the event of sanitary procedures. The usage of picket tubs for fermentation has the benefit of enabling a variety of microorganisms living in the Wooden to influence sake, enabling more elaborate fermentation and making sake with distinct characteristics. It is additionally identified which the antioxidants contained in wood Have got a constructive impact on sake.[45][46]
